{-# LANGUAGE MultiWayIf #-}
{-# LANGUAGE OverloadedStrings #-}
-- | Helpers for putting git pack protocol elements.
module Network.Git.Put
( -- * Object ID
zeroObjId
, putObjId
-- * Capability
, serializeSharedCapability
, serializeFetchCapability
, putlenCapabilitiesFetch
-- * Pkt Line
, putFlushPkt
, putDataPkt
-- * Common Lines
, putTaggedObjId
-- * Service
, serializeService
)
where
import Control.Monad (when)
import Data.Binary.Put
import Data.Bool (bool)
import Data.ByteString (ByteString)
import Data.Foldable (traverse_)
import Data.Git.Harder (ObjId (..))
--import Data.Git.Named (RefName (..))
import Data.Git.Ref (fromHex, toHex)
--import Data.Git.Repository (branchList, tagList)
--import Data.Git.Storage (Git, getObject)
--import Data.Git.Storage.Object (Object (ObjTag))
--import Data.Git.Types (Tag (tagRef))
import Data.Monoid ((<>))
import qualified Data.ByteString as B
import Data.Binary.Put.Local
import Network.Git.Types
zeroObjId :: ObjId
zeroObjId = ObjId $ fromHex $ B.replicate 40 48 -- 40 times '0'
putObjId :: ObjId -> Put
putObjId (ObjId ref) = putByteString $ toHex ref
serializeSharedCapability :: SharedCapability -> ByteString
serializeSharedCapability cap =
case cap of
CapOfsDelta -> "ofs-delta"
CapSideBand64k -> "side-band-64k"
CapAgent agent -> "agent=" <> agent
serializeFetchCapability :: FetchCapability -> ByteString
serializeFetchCapability cap =
case cap of
CapMultiAck -> "multi_ack"
CapMultiAckDetailed -> "multi_ack_detailed"
CapNoDone -> "no-done"
CapThinPack True -> "thin-pack"
CapThinPack False -> "no-thin"
CapSideBand -> "side-band"
CapShallow -> "shallow"
CapNoProgress -> "no-progres"
CapIncludeTag -> "include-tag"
CapAllowTipSHA1InWant -> "allow-tip-sha1-in-want"
CapAllowReachableSha1InWant -> "allow-reachable-sha1-in-want"
putlenCapabilitiesFetch
:: [SharedCapability] -> [FetchCapability] -> (Put, Int)
putlenCapabilitiesFetch scaps fcaps =
let ss = map serializeSharedCapability scaps
fs = map serializeFetchCapability fcaps
slens = map B.length ss
flens = map B.length fs
foldLen = foldr $ \ x s -> x + 1 + s
len = case (slens, flens) of
([], []) -> 0
(n:ns, []) -> foldLen n ns
([], m:ms) -> foldLen m ms
(n:ns, m:ms) -> foldLen n ns + 1 + foldLen m ms
putCaps [] = return ()
putCaps (b:bs) = do
putByteString b
traverse_ (\ c -> putSpace >> putByteString c) bs
put = case (null ss, null fs) of
(True, True) -> return ()
(False, True) -> putCaps ss
(True, False) -> putCaps fs
(False, False) -> putCaps ss >> putSpace >> putCaps fs
in (put, len)
putFlushPkt :: Put
putFlushPkt = putByteString "0000" >> flush
putDataPkt :: Bool -> Int -> Put -> Put
putDataPkt addLF payloadLen payloadPut =
let len = bool id (+1) addLF $ payloadLen
in if | len == 0 -> fail "tried to put an empty pkt-line"
| len > 65520 -> fail "payload bigger than maximal pkt-len"
| otherwise -> do
putHex16 $ len + 4
payloadPut
when addLF $ putLF
putTaggedObjId :: ByteString -> ObjId -> Put
putTaggedObjId tag oid =
let len = B.length tag + 1 + 40
in putDataPkt True len $ do
putByteString tag
putSpace
putObjId oid
serializeService :: Service -> ByteString
serializeService UploadPack = "git-upload-pack"
